Process to produce a vinylidene chloride-based heteropolymer
View Patent ↗A process to prepare a vinylidene chloride heteropolymer comprising copolymerizing vinylidene chloride with at least one comonomer selected from the group consisting of alkyl acrylates, non-vinylidene chloride vinyl monomers and combinations thereof in the presence of an indicator, wherein the indicator is soluble in vinylidene chloride, the at least one comonomer, or a mixture of the vinylidene chloride and the at least one comonomer is provided.
1. A process to prepare a vinylidene chloride copolymer, wherein the process comprises:
copolymerizing vinylidene chloride with at least one comonomer selected from the group consisting of an alkyl acrylate, a non-vinylidene chloride vinyl monomer and combinations thereof in the presence of an indicator, wherein the indicator is soluble in vinylidene chloride, the at least one comonomer, or a mixture of the vinylidene chloride and the at least one comonomer, and wherein the indicator is 2,2′-(2,5-thiophenylenediyl)bis(5-tert-butylbenzoxazole).
2. The process according to claim 1 , wherein the at least one comonomer is methyl acrylate or vinyl chloride.
3. The process according to claim 1 , wherein the copolymerizing occurs in a suspension polymerization process.
4. The process according to claim 1 , wherein the copolymerizing occurs in an emulsion polymerization process.
5. The process according to claim 1 , further comprising adding at least one additive selected from the group consisting of a plasticizer and an epoxidized oil.
6. The process according to claim 5 , wherein prior to polymerization, the indicator used for addition is prepared by uniformly mixing it with at least a portion of at least one from the group selected from vinylidene chloride, the at least one comonomer, and the at least one additive.
7. The process according to claim 1 , further comprising adding a suspending agent to the vinylidene chloride and at least one comonomer prior to the copolymerizing step.
